본문 바로가기

리눅스

GitLab에서 리포지토리 미러링을 구성하는 방법

반응형

GitLab에서 리포지토리 미러링을 구성하는 방법(gitlab -> github 미러링)

구성

github 리포지토리 생성 및 tokens 생성

repository 생성

  • repository name : gitlab_mirror

tokens 생성

  • Settings > Developer settings > Personal access tokens

<토큰 생성>
<토큰 권한 설정>
<토큰 복사>

728x90

gitlab 프로젝트 생성 및 미러링 설정

프로젝트 생성

  • 프로젝트 그룹 : testG
  • 프로젝트 이름 : gitlab_source

미러링 설정

  • testG > gitlab_source > 저장소 설정
    • Git 저장소 URL : https://아이디@github.com/아이디/gitlab_morror.git
    • 미러 방향 : Push
    • 인증 방법 : 패스워드
    • 패스워드 : 26911096892ee9823056dfae08e771797d51

<미러링 저장소 설정>
<미러링된 저장소>

gitlab 미러링

gitlab 프로젝트

<gitlab>

github 리포지토리

 

참고URL

- https://docs.gitlab.com/ee/user/project/repository/mirror/

 

728x90
반응형